Solution for 6y=-2(1-5y)+6 equation:



6y=-2(1-5y)+6
We move all terms to the left:
6y-(-2(1-5y)+6)=0
We add all the numbers together, and all the variables
6y-(-2(-5y+1)+6)=0
We calculate terms in parentheses: -(-2(-5y+1)+6), so:
-2(-5y+1)+6
We multiply parentheses
10y-2+6
We add all the numbers together, and all the variables
10y+4
Back to the equation:
-(10y+4)
We get rid of parentheses
6y-10y-4=0
We add all the numbers together, and all the variables
-4y-4=0
We move all terms containing y to the left, all other terms to the right
-4y=4
y=4/-4
y=-1
